Knuth-Morris-Pratt Apply FSM to string by processing

characters one at a time. Accepting state is reached when pattern

is found. Space O(m+n) Time O(m+n) Handbook of Algorithms and Data

Structureshttp://www.dcc.uchile.cl/~rbaeza/handbook/algs/7/712.srch.c.html

CSE 8337 Spring 2005 12

Boyer-Moore Scan pattern from right to left Skip many positions on illegal

character string. O(mn) Expected time better than KMP Expected behavior better Handbook of Algorithms and Data Structureshttp://www.dcc.uchile.cl/~rbaeza/handbook/algs/7/713.preproc.c.html

String-to-String Correction Measure of similarity between strings Can be used to determine how to convert

from one string to another Cost to convert one to the other Transformations

Match: Current characters in both strings are the same

Delete: Delete current character in input string Insert: Insert current character in target string

into string
